1 SABERTON CLOSE is a very small detached house of 80m², built sometime between 2003 and 2006. It was last sold for £360,000 in July 2024, which was around 39% below the average July 2024 detached price in the South Cambridgesh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was March 2009,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was C.

1 SABERTON CLOSE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the South Cambridgesh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 1 SABERTON CLOSE sales between July 2006 and July 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2017 sale was for 38%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 38% below the HPI over time, until the July 2024 sale, where it falls to 39%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 39% below the HPI.
